More stress has been given to the Limit State Method of Analysis which is based on the ultimate strength of the structures. More examples on Limit State Method of Analysis and Design have been included. Limit State Method of Design has been illustrated in the Chapters on Foundation and Footing (Chapter 9) as well as for Retaining Walls In Chapter 13, in which Design features of Building Frames have provided including provisions in Limit State Method, a section has been included for discussion on Seismic Method of Analysis for Buildings. This will be helpful for the students and the designers. In Chapter 16, a section has been included on the Design of Overhead Water Tanks and Staging. An example on Design of an Overhead Water Tank including the staging has been inserted. Chapter 15, discussing Yield Lime Theory and Strip Methods has been retained, as these are connected with the ulitmate Design of Reinforced Concrete Slabs. Chapter 17, dealing with Deflections, Limit Method of Analysis and Cracking of concrete are important when design of structures are done on basis of ultimate strengths. A new Chapter on Deep Beam has been included as Chapter 19 with several examples on design of Deep Beam, used in hoppers, sides. Chapter 20 has been added for discussion as Distribution of Concentrated Loads, other related problems and Design of Bridges and Box Culverts. Suitable examples on Design of Slab and Deck Girder Bridges and Box Culverts have also been included. Besides a typical design of a R.C. Jetty supported on piles has also been included.
